Noun: adulator  'a-dyu,ley-tu(t) or 'a-ju,ley-tu(r)
  1. A person who uses flattery
    "The adulator showered his boss with insincere compliments";
    - flatterer

Derived forms: adulators

Type of: acolyte, follower
